Acknowledging a sad reality

Bei-Lok Hu has a nice paper on the arXiv, Emergence: Key physical issues for deeper philosophical inquiries. The acknowledgements end with the poignant (and sad) observation:
 This kind of non mission-driven, non utilitarian work addressing purely intellectual issues is not expected to be supported by any U.S. grant agency.
